Category Introduction: Transistors - IGBTs - Single
Definition:
Single IGBTs (Insulated Gate Bipolar Transistors) are a specialized type of power semiconductor device within the broader category of Discrete Semiconductor Products. Combining the high-speed switching capability of MOSFETs with the high-voltage handling of bipolar transistors, IGBTs are optimized for efficient power control in high-current, high-voltage applications. Single IGBTs refer to discrete, standalone components (as opposed to modules), offering flexibility in circuit design and thermal management.
Types of Products in This Category:
1. NPT (Non-Punch Through) IGBTs: Cost-effective with robust performance in medium-frequency applications.
2. PT (Punch Through) IGBTs: Higher efficiency for high-frequency switching, often used in SMPS and inverters.
3. Trench-Gate IGBTs: Advanced designs with lower saturation voltage (VCE(sat)), minimizing conduction losses.
4. Ultrafast/Rugged IGBTs: Engineered for extreme conditions (e.g., industrial motor drives), featuring short-circuit tolerance and soft recovery diodes.
Key specifications vary by voltage rating (600V 1700V+), current capacity, and switching speed.
Purchasing Recommendations:
1. Match Voltage/Current Ratings: Ensure the IGBT s VCES and IC exceed your circuit s maximum requirements by 20 30% for safety margins.
2. Evaluate Switching Losses: Prioritize low Eoff (turn-off energy) for high-frequency designs to reduce heat dissipation.
3. Thermal Management: Verify package type (TO-247, TO-220, etc.) aligns with your PCB s heat-sinking capabilities.
4. Application-Specific Features: Opt for ruggedized variants for motor control or soft-diode IGBTs to mitigate EMI in resonant circuits.
5. Supplier Reliability: Source from vendors providing detailed SOA (Safe Operating Area) charts and lifetime durability data.
Single IGBTs are pivotal in energy-efficient systems from EV chargers to renewable energy inverters. Selecting the right variant ensures optimal performance, longevity, and cost savings in high-power designs.
